What are some common mistakes organizations make when filling out a VPAT?

Question

What are some common mistakes organizations make when filling out a VPAT?

Answer

One of the biggest issues is simply overlooking accessibility problems during manual testing—either because the team doesn’t know how to test properly, can’t identify certain issues, or isn’t sure how to fix them. Accessibility auditing requires specific skills, and without that expertise, it’s easy to miss critical barriers.

Another common mistake is relying solely on in-house testing and self-reporting. While that’s better than nothing, a VPAT carries much more credibility when it's based on third-party testing. It’s a bit like car manufacturers making claims about towing capacity—if those claims come from independent testing, they’re a lot more trustworthy. The same goes for accessibility: a VPAT validated by an unbiased expert adds weight and legitimacy to your claims.
